Lieutenant Col. Lauren Edwards, the commanding officer of 8th Engineer Support Battalion, recognizes Marines in her unit for all of the hours they put in to volunteering during a ceremony held at Camp Lejeune, N. C., April 27, 2016. After thanking the battalion volunteers as a whole, Edwards asked individuals to stand so she could share their accomplishments in volunteering with the rest of the service members in attendance.
